package apps
import (
"bytes"
"fmt"
"net/url"
"strings"
"github.com/datasance/iofog-go-sdk/v3/pkg/client"
"gopkg.in/yaml.v2"
)
const (
errParseControllerURL = "failed to parse Controller endpoint as URL: %s"
)
// ApplicationData is data fetched from controller at init time
type ApplicationData struct {
MicroserviceByName map[string]*client.MicroserviceInfo
AgentsByName map[string]*client.AgentInfo
CatalogByID map[int]*client.CatalogItemInfo
RegistryByID map[int]*client.RegistryInfo
CatalogByName map[string]*client.CatalogItemInfo
FlowInfo *client.FlowInfo
}
type microserviceExecutor struct {
controller IofogController
msvc interface{}
name string
appName string
uuid string
client *client.Client
}
func ParseFQMsvcName(fqName string) (appName, name string, err error) {
if fqName == "" {
return "", "", NewInputError(fmt.Sprintf("Invalid microservice name %s", fqName))
}
splittedName := strings.Split(fqName, "/")
switch len(splittedName) {
case 1:
return "", splittedName[0], nil
case 2:
return splittedName[0], splittedName[1], nil
default:
return "", "", NewInputError(fmt.Sprintf("Invalid microservice name %s", fqName))
}
}
func newMicroserviceExecutor(controller IofogController, msvc interface{}, appName, name string) *microserviceExecutor {
exe := µserviceExecutor{
controller: controller,
msvc: msvc,
name: name,
appName: appName,
}
return exe
}
func (exe *microserviceExecutor) execute() error {
// Init remote resources
if err := exe.init(); err != nil {
return err
}
// Deploy microservice
if _, err := exe.deploy(); err != nil {
return err
}
return nil
}
func (exe *microserviceExecutor) init() (err error) {
baseURL, err := url.Parse(exe.controller.Endpoint)
if err != nil {
return fmt.Errorf(errParseControllerURL, err.Error())
}
if exe.controller.Token != "" {
exe.client, err = client.NewWithToken(client.Options{BaseURL: baseURL}, exe.controller.Token)
} else {
exe.client, err = client.NewAndLogin(client.Options{BaseURL: baseURL}, exe.controller.Email, exe.controller.Password)
}
if err != nil {
return err
}
if exe.appName == "" {
return NewInputError(fmt.Sprintf("Application name missing for microservice %s", exe.name))
}
listMsvcs, err := exe.client.GetMicroservicesByApplication(exe.appName)
if err != nil {
return err
}
for i := 0; i < len(listMsvcs.Microservices); i++ {
// If msvc already exists, set UUID
if listMsvcs.Microservices[i].Name == exe.name {
if exe.uuid == "" {
exe.uuid = listMsvcs.Microservices[i].UUID
}
}
}
return err
}
func (exe *microserviceExecutor) deploy() (newMsvc *client.MicroserviceInfo, err error) {
if exe.uuid != "" {
// Update microservice
return exe.update()
}
// Create microservice
return exe.create()
}
func (exe *microserviceExecutor) create() (newMsvc *client.MicroserviceInfo, err error) {
file := IofogHeader{
APIVersion: "datasance.com/v1",
Kind: MicroserviceKind,
Metadata: HeaderMetadata{
Name: strings.Join([]string{exe.appName, exe.name}, "/"),
},
Spec: exe.msvc,
}
yamlBytes, err := yaml.Marshal(file)
if err != nil {
return nil, err
}
return exe.client.CreateMicroserviceFromYAML(bytes.NewReader(yamlBytes))
}
func (exe *microserviceExecutor) update() (newMsvc *client.MicroserviceInfo, err error) {
file := IofogHeader{
APIVersion: "datasance.com/v1",
Kind: MicroserviceKind,
Metadata: HeaderMetadata{
Name: strings.Join([]string{exe.appName, exe.name}, "/"),
},
Spec: exe.msvc,
}
yamlBytes, err := yaml.Marshal(file)
if err != nil {
return nil, err
}
return exe.client.UpdateMicroserviceFromYAML(exe.uuid, bytes.NewReader(yamlBytes))
}
